I'm setting up a brand-new TS664. I installed HBS 3. I created a shared folder "tmbackups" and user "tmbackup" with write privileges to tmbackups (verified, can mount, create folder).

When I go to add the backup to either of my two macs, it's stuck on "Mounting" the disk.

I am not using the default TimeMachine user, but this should all work, right?

QNAP have a good tutorial for this.
SMB is recommended, and works for me.
Switch off the hbs3 Time Machine on QNAP.
Enable SMB, min version 2 on QNAP.
Switch off bonjour on QNAP unless you need it for something else, and see next step.
Connect to your server share from MAC using the SMB shown in the tutorial.
Now you have a disk to select from Mac Time Machine. Select it, enter password for the share when prompted.
Backup should start soon.
